The Iran national women's cricket team is the team that represents the country of Iran in international women's cricket matches. They made their international debut when they played at ACC Women’s Twenty20 Championship 2009 losing to Nepal in July 2009,[1] since then took part in the ACC Women’s Championship 2013[2] and ACC Women's Premier 2014.[3]

Tournament history

Host/Year Round/Rank
Malaysia ACC Women’s Twenty20 Championship 20098th place
Thailand ACC Women’s Championship 20136th place
Thailand ACC Women's Premier 20146th place

Head coaches

  • Pakistan Shamsa Hashmi 2008-2009
  • Pakistan Hajira Sarwar 2010-2013
  • Iran Mozhdeh Bavandpour 2014-

Captains

  • Nahid Hakimian 2009
  • Somayyeh Sahrapour 2013
  • Nasimeh Rahshetaei 2014-
